Air Serbia, Serbia’s national airline, will launch direct flights between Belgrade and Tbilisi, the capital of Georgia, starting 15th June 2025.
The airline will operate three weekly flights on Mondays, Thursdays, and Sundays from Belgrade, while Tbilisi-bound flights will depart on Tuesdays, Fridays, and Sundays.
Tickets are now available on airserbia.com and via the airline’s mobile app.
